Step-by-Step: How to Sell Toncoin via Bank Transfer in Miami
Follow this proven process for seamless transactions:
- Choose a Miami-Friendly Exchange: Select platforms supporting TON/USD pairs and ACH/wire transfers (e.g., Kraken, Bybit)
- Complete KYC Verification: Submit ID, proof of Miami address, and SSN for compliance
- Transfer Toncoin to Exchange: Send TON from your wallet to the exchange deposit address
- Sell TON for USD: Execute a market/limit order during peak liquidity hours (9AM-4PM EST)
- Initiate Bank Withdrawal: Select ‘Bank Transfer’ and enter your Miami bank details (routing/account number)
- Track & Confirm: Monitor transaction status via exchange dashboard and bank notifications

Essential Security Tips for Miami Sellers
- Verify exchange licenses (FinCEN registration)
- Enable 2FA and whitelist withdrawal addresses
- Confirm bank account digits via micro-deposit verification
- Never share online banking credentials
- Use dedicated crypto accounts at Miami banks like BAC or Citi

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What’s the minimum Toncoin I can sell via bank transfer?
A: Most exchanges require at least $10-25 worth of TON for bank withdrawals. P2P platforms allow smaller sales.
Q: How long do Miami bank transfers take?
A: ACH transfers clear in 1-3 business days. Same-day wires cost $15-30 but settle within hours.
Q: Are Toncoin sales taxable in Florida?
A: Yes—federal capital gains tax applies. Track cost basis using tools like CoinTracker and report on IRS Form 8949.
Q: Can I sell Toncoin without ID verification?
A> No. Miami exchanges require full KYC under FinCEN regulations to prevent money laundering.
Q: What bank transfer fees should I expect?
A> Typical costs: Exchange withdrawal fee ($0-25) + possible bank incoming wire fee ($15). ACH is usually free.
